COVID-19 update: 85 new cases of all ages groups

MOHAVE COUNTY – Late Monday afternoon, the Mohave County Health Department (MCDPH) Nursing staff was notified of 85 new COVID-19 confirmed cases. Thirty-five of the new cases are in the Bullhead City service area. There are also 32 cases in the Lake Havasu City service area. The Kingman service area has 15 new cases. North County has three new cases.

Of the 35 Bullhead City area cases, all of them remain under investigation and although they are confirmed positives, more information is required. Two cases are 0-10; three cases are 11-19; one case is 20-29; seven cases are 30-39; ten cases are 40-49; four cases are 50-59; four cases are 60-69; two cases are 70-79; two cases are 80-89.

Of the 32 Lake Havasu City area cases, all of them remain under investigation at this time. Two of them are 0-10; two are 11-19; three are 20-29; five are 30-39; three are 40-49; six are 50-59; six are 60-69; four are 70-79; one is 80-89.

Of the 15 cases in the Kingman service area, 12 remain under investigation. Five are 20-29; one is 30-39; two are 40-49; one is 60-69; two are 70-79; one is 90+. The remaining three Kingman area cases are recovering at home and are linked to other confirmed cases. Two are 50-59 and ne is 80-89.

Finally, there are three confirmed cases in the North County area. All three are under investigation. One is 40-49; one is 50-59; one 70-79.

There are now 542 positive confirmed cases in the Lake Havasu City area, including 14 deaths, 409 in Kingman, with a total of 46 deaths there, and 38 cases in “North County,” formerly referred to as “Other”(composed of a number of smaller Mohave County communities,) and 910 in Bullhead City, including 33 deaths. There are now a total of 93 deaths in the county from the disease. Total positive cases, 1,899.

The average age of all Mohave County positive cases is now 48.4 years old.

The average age of deaths from COVID-19 in Mohave County is now 78.2.

As of now the MCDPH is reporting a total of 581 recovered cases in the county. This will be updated once a week on Mondays for the previous week.
